The ideal table should not only fit comfortably in your dining space but also provide enough room for each guest to enjoy their meal without feeling cramped. Typically, a rectangular dining table works best for larger gatherings. A table that is at least 72 inches long can accommodate 6 people on each side. However, if you want to ensure that all 12 guests are comfortable, consider a table that is 96 inches or longer. Round tables can also work for larger groups but often require a diameter of at least 72 inches to seat 12 comfortably. If you have a square table, it should ideally measure at least 72 inches on each side. Additionally, consider the width of the table. A table that is between 36 and 48 inches wide will provide enough space for serving dishes and allow for easy conversation. Don't forget to factor in the space around the table; you should aim for at least 36 inches of clearance on all sides to allow guests to move in and out easily. Another option for accommodating larger groups is to use a table with extensions. Many dining tables come with leaves that can be added or removed, allowing you to adjust the size based on your needs. This flexibility can be particularly useful for those who may not entertain large groups on a regular basis but want the option to do so. In summary, for a dining table that accommodates 12 people, look for a rectangular table that is at least 96 inches long or a round table with a diameter of 72 inches or more. Remember to leave adequate space around the table for comfort and ease of movement.
